CI failures on Quillstack's plugin matrix are usually pool exhaustion, not flaky tests. The shared Postgres runner caps connections at 20; plugins that open their own pool must close it in teardown. Set pool size to 2 in CI, disable keepalive probes, and check the runner log for "saturated" warnings. If stuck, attach the token printed at the end of the failing stage.

trace token, fafog-kageg: htk4_98e6

The renewal of our three-year agreement with Torvane Materials has been assessed in detail. Proposed terms include a 4.2% unit-price increase, partially offset by improved volume rebates and extended payment terms of sixty days. Sensitivity analysis indicates a net annual cost impact of under 1% on the Meridia product line, assuming stable demand. Legal has flagged no material changes to liability clauses. We recommend approval, subject to the conditions outlined in the confidential note below.

confidential, yawip-bahif: Zorokox Partners plans to lower the Casax list price by 28.0 percent in April. The board signed off on a budget of $271.0 million for Project Juldor. The renewal with Pelokox Partners closes at $410.1 million a year, 3.4 percent below the last contract. Project Pelok slips by a full year because of the audit delay.

### RestockPilot: Release Prerequisites

Before cutting a release, confirm that the RestockPilot planner can reach the SnackGrid inventory service, since the build pipeline runs an integration smoke test against staging during packaging. A failed handshake here blocks the release tag, so verify credentials first. The pipeline reads its staging credential from the deploy config; for reference and manual verification, the current key appears below.

service key, tajof-fawip: vxb4-JNOz

## Further Reading

Fixturesmith is our test-data factory library, used across most Lanternbay services. The examples above cover basic factories and trait composition; for sequences, associations, and database-seeding strategies, see the extended docs. Ahead of this week's eng sync, reviewers should skim the migration notes from the old seeder scripts, available on the internal page.

runbook for tafof-yawif: https://confluence.tolvaqsys.internal/display/display/browse/pages/7be3